What this degree looks like at Full Sail University
While the career paths listed represent the high end of the tech industry, your initial post-graduation reality may look different. Full Sail’s curriculum is known for its accelerated, hands-on focus, which can be great for landing entry-level roles quickly, particularly in Orlando’s vibrant entertainment and simulation tech scene with employers like EA Tiburon. However, this model may not provide the deep theoretical foundation or research opportunities that top-tier tech firms like Google or Microsoft often seek for their highest-paying software engineering positions.
The lower earnings data reflects this dynamic: graduates are entering the workforce, but often in regional markets or roles that don't command Silicon Valley salaries at the start. Your key to maximizing this degree is aggressive networking and portfolio building. Proactively seek internships and build complex, impressive projects that demonstrate skills far beyond your coursework to compete for higher-paying roles nationwide.

How does Full Sail University's Computer Science program score?
A score of 57/100 reflects decent absolute metrics, but Full Sail University trails the majority of Computer Science programs on relative rankings. Context matters more than the raw number.
How vulnerable is Computer Science to AI automation?
AI won't 'replace' Computer Science careers outright, but it is likely to reduce the number of job openings. We model 72% task exposure, which compresses field employment probability in our scenarios.
Why are Computer Science earnings lower at Full Sail University?
Lower starting pay at Full Sail University may reflect local labor market conditions rather than program quality. Many graduates see convergence with national averages within 3-5 years.
